Kamilla Cardoso, who spent one season with the Syracuse women’s basketball program, will transfer to the University of South Carolina, the school announced Friday. Cardoso signed a financial aid agreement to join the Gamecocks, according to a release. She has four years of eligibility remaining.

Priscilla Williams will be ready to suit up when the time comes for the Syracuse women’s basketball team to return to action. The freshman guard announced Thursday night that she was medically cleared from an upper-body injury she sustained against Florida State during the quarterfinal round of the ACC tournament. She left the game on a stretcher and was taken to a local hospital for further evaluation.

The women’s basketball coach at Syracuse said he didn’t quite know what to say when one of his young sons asked him if he was in the transfer portal. It was a valid question for a kid dad has had 11 players enter the NCAA transfer portal since the pandemic-plagued season ended. “We’ve got a lot going on,” Hillsman said this week on a Zoom call. “The main thing for us is we’re in a good place and we’re not in a panic mode.”
